#b5fbad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5fbad is composed of 71% red, 98.4%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 83.1%. #b5fbad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6bf75b.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#b5fbad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b5fbad has RGB values of R:181, G:251,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11926445.

Hex triplet b5fbad #b5fbad
RGB Decimal 181, 251, 173 rgb(181,251,173)
RGB Percent 71, 98.4, 67.8 rgb(71%,98.4%,67.8%)
CMYK 28, 0, 31, 2
HSL 113.8°, 90.7, 83.1 hsl(113.8,90.7%,83.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 113.8°, 31.1, 98.4
Web Safe ccff99 #ccff99
CIE-LAB 92.501, -36.169, 30.631
XYZ 61.094, 81.833, 52.109
xyY 0.313, 0.42, 81.833
CIE-LCH 92.501, 47.397, 139.74
CIE-LUV 92.501, -34.528, 49.76
Hunter-Lab 90.462, -37.757, 29.17
Binary 10110101, 11111011, 10101101

Shades and Tints of #b5fbad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c01 is the darkest color, while #f9f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5fbad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2d7d1 is the less saturated color, while #b2feaa is the most saturated one.
